Creative Illustration Minor

The Creative Illustration minor prepares students for a dynamic artistic landscape where creative fields overlap, and visual storytelling reaches diverse audiences. This program equips students with the skills and industry insight to craft compelling narratives across multiple platforms. Career opportunities span surface design, children’s books, editorial illustration (magazine, newspaper, and book covers), technical art, and advertising illustration. By blending traditional and contemporary techniques, students develop a versatile portfolio that supports both career opportunities and future graduate study in illustration, fine art, and related fields.

Grade Requirement for Minor


A student must earn a grade of “C” or better in each course applied toward meeting the requirement of a minor.
